Introduction

The Tupperware Speedy Chef is a versatile manual food processor designed for quick and efficient preparation of various ingredients. It is ideal for whipping cream, beating eggs, making mayonnaise, and even churning butter. Its hand-crank mechanism provides control and convenience without the need for electricity.

Product Overview

The Tupperware Speedy Chef consists of several key components that work together to facilitate manual food preparation. Understanding each part is essential for proper assembly and operation.

Components:

  • Container: The transparent red base where ingredients are processed.
  • Lid: The red cover with a white ring that fits onto the container.
  • Whisk Attachment: The red whisking mechanism that rotates inside the container.
  • Crank Handle: The red handle with a white knob used to manually operate the whisk.

Setup

Before first use, wash all components thoroughly. Ensure all parts are dry before assembly.

  1. Place the transparent red container on a stable, flat surface. The anti-slip ring on the base helps secure it.
  2. Insert the whisk attachment into the center of the container.
  3. Align the lid with the top of the container and press down firmly to ensure a snug fit.
  4. Attach the crank handle to the designated slot on the lid. Ensure it clicks into place or is securely fastened.

Operating Instructions

The Speedy Chef is designed for manual operation, offering control over the mixing process.

  1. Prepare Ingredients: Add your desired ingredients into the container. Do not overfill; ensure there is enough space for the whisk to operate effectively.
  2. Secure the Lid: Place the lid onto the container. While the lid does not feature a locking mechanism, it is designed to fit snugly. For optimal stability and safety during operation, firmly hold the lid down with one hand while rotating the crank handle with the other. This prevents the lid from lifting or the contents from splashing.
  3. Operate the Crank: Rotate the crank handle in a continuous motion. The speed of rotation can be adjusted manually to achieve the desired consistency for your ingredients.
  4. Monitor Progress: The transparent container allows you to observe the mixing process. Continue cranking until your ingredients reach the desired texture, such as whipped cream, beaten eggs, or churned butter.
  5. Remove Ingredients: Once complete, carefully remove the crank handle and then the lid. Use a spatula to scrape down the sides of the container and remove the processed ingredients.

Maintenance and Cleaning

Proper cleaning and maintenance will ensure the longevity and hygiene of your Tupperware Speedy Chef.

  1. Disassembly: After each use, disassemble all components: remove the crank handle, lift the lid, and detach the whisk attachment from the lid.
  2. Washing: Wash all parts immediately after use with warm, soapy water. Use a soft sponge or cloth to clean the container, lid, and whisk. Rinse thoroughly to remove all soap residue.
  3. Drying: Allow all components to air dry completely before reassembling or storing. This prevents water spots and potential odor buildup.
  4. Storage: Store the clean, dry Speedy Chef in a cool, dry place. You may store it assembled or disassembled, depending on your preference and available space.

Note: While Tupperware products are often dishwasher safe, hand washing is recommended for the Speedy Chef to preserve its finish and ensure thorough cleaning of all intricate parts.

Troubleshooting

If you encounter any issues while using your Speedy Chef, refer to the following common solutions:

  • Difficulty Churning/Mixing:
    • Ensure the whisk attachment is correctly seated in the lid and rotates freely.
    • Check that the crank handle is securely attached.
    • Verify that the container is not overfilled, which can impede whisk movement.
    • For butter or whipped cream, ensure ingredients are at the correct temperature (e.g., cold cream for whipping).
  • Lid Lifting During Operation:
    • As noted in the operating instructions, the lid does not lock. Always hold the lid firmly with one hand while cranking with the other to maintain stability and prevent it from lifting.
  • Splashing of Contents:
    • Ensure the lid is properly seated and held down during operation.
    • Do not overfill the container.
    • Avoid excessively vigorous cranking, especially with liquid ingredients.
